Samsung has unveiled its first UFS 5.0 storage chip, which it claims is also the world’s fastest. Designed for smartphones and tablets, the new storage solution offers a significant performance boost over the UFS 4.x storage chips used in current devices such as the Galaxy S26 Ultra. It could debut in the Galaxy S27 series in early 2027.
The new storage chip is based on the latest embedded storage interface standard from Joint Electron Device Engineering Council (JEDEC). Samsung claims its UFS 5.0 chip delivers sequential read speeds of up to 10.8GB/s and sequential write speeds of up to 9.5GB/s.
Those figures are more than twice as fast as UFS 4.1 storage and represent the highest UFS 5.0 speeds announced in the world so far. The chip measures just 7.5 × 13 × 0.9mm, making it 16.7% smaller than Samsung’s UFS 4.1 solution.
| UFS 4.1 | UFS 5.0 | |
|---|---|---|
| Sequential Read Speed | 4.3GB/s | 10.8GB/s |
| Sequential Write Speed | 4.3GB/s | 9.5GB/s |
The speed improvements could lead to faster app launches, quicker file transfers, and better overall device responsiveness. They could also help accelerate the processing of large datasets used by on-device AI applications.
Samsung says its UFS 5.0 chip is 40% more power-efficient than its UFS 4.1 storage. In theory, that should translate into longer battery life. The company used various technologies such as clock gating and multi-voltage operation to bring those efficiency improvements.
Samsung plans to start mass production of its UFS 5.0 chips in the fourth quarter of 2026. The storage solution will be available in capacities of up to 1TB. In addition to smartphones and tablets, it can also be used in laptops, smartwatches, and extended reality (XR) devices.
Jangseok Choi, Head of Memory Product Planning at Samsung Electronics, said, “In the era of on-device AI, storage devices are evolving into a key driver defining AI experiences. As we successfully move beyond the development stage of the industry’s first UFS 5.0 solution, Samsung is setting a new standard for storage on the go and will continue to drive innovation for the next-generation mobile platform market.”
